Switzerland’s energy transition is built on three core pillars:
- Reducing Fossil Fuel Dependence
- Expanding Renewable Energy Sources
- Improving Energy Efficiency and Innovation
Each of these components plays a crucial role in reshaping Switzerland’s energy landscape and ensuring a smooth transition to sustainability.
1. Phasing Out Fossil Fuels
Switzerland’s plan includes gradually eliminating fossil fuel-based energy sources, such as coal, oil, and natural gas, which currently account for a significant portion of the country’s CO₂ emissions.
Key Measures to Reduce Fossil Fuel Use
- Stronger Regulations on CO₂ Emissions: The government is imposing stricter carbon taxes on industries and businesses that heavily rely on fossil fuels.
- Incentives for Electric Vehicles (EVs): Expanding EV infrastructure, increasing subsidies for electric cars, and gradually reducing fuel-powered vehicle registrations.
- Sustainable Heating Solutions: Phasing out oil and gas heating systems in residential and commercial buildings, replacing them with heat pumps, solar thermal systems, and district heating networks.
2. Accelerating Renewable Energy Development
To replace fossil fuels, Switzerland is heavily investing in renewable energy production, focusing on:
Hydropower: The Backbone of Swiss Energy
- Hydropower already supplies over 55% of Switzerland’s electricity.
- Investments in modernizing hydroelectric plants and improving storage capabilities will further enhance efficiency and reliability.
- The government is developing new pumped-storage hydropower facilities, which act as massive “batteries” by storing excess electricity for later use.
Solar and Wind Energy Expansion
- Switzerland is rapidly scaling up solar energy, with new laws requiring solar panels on all new buildings.
- The country is increasing wind energy capacity, especially in regions with favorable conditions such as the Jura mountains and Alpine passes.
- By 2050, solar and wind power are expected to contribute up to 30% of the country’s total electricity generation.
Exploring Emerging Renewable Technologies
- Geothermal Energy: Using underground heat sources to generate electricity and provide sustainable heating.
- Bioenergy: Converting organic waste and biomass into clean energy.
- Green Hydrogen: Developing hydrogen fuel technologies for transport and industry.
3. Enhancing Energy Efficiency and Innovation
Switzerland is not just focusing on producing clean energy—it is also working to reduce overall energy consumption through efficiency measures and cutting-edge innovation.
Energy Efficiency in Buildings
- New construction projects must follow strict energy-efficiency standards (e.g., Minergie certification).
- Existing buildings are being retrofitted with better insulation, smart heating systems, and energy-efficient lighting.
Sustainable Transportation
- Switzerland is expanding public transport networks, making trains, buses, and trams more attractive alternatives to private cars.
- Increased investment in bicycle infrastructure to encourage eco-friendly commuting.
Smart Grids and Digital Energy Management
- Smart grids are being implemented to optimize electricity distribution, reducing waste and enhancing grid stability.
- AI and IoT technologies are being used to manage energy consumption in homes, businesses, and industrial facilities.
Challenges in Switzerland’s Energy Transition
While Switzerland’s energy transition is ambitious, it faces several challenges that must be addressed to ensure success.
1. Energy Supply Reliability
- As Switzerland moves away from fossil fuels, ensuring a stable and reliable energy supply—especially during winter months when solar and hydroelectric output is lower—remains a challenge.
- Solutions include cross-border energy partnerships with European countries and investments in energy storage technologies.
2. Public and Private Investment
- Transitioning to a carbon-neutral economy requires substantial financial investment.
- While government subsidies and incentives help, private sector participation is crucial in funding large-scale renewable energy projects.
3. Resistance to Change
- Some businesses and industries reliant on fossil fuels are resistant to rapid changes.
- There is also public concern about higher costs associated with renewable energy infrastructure and carbon taxes.
4. Environmental and Land Use Considerations
- Expanding wind and solar farms requires careful planning to protect biodiversity and minimize land conflicts.
- Hydropower projects must balance energy production with environmental conservation efforts to protect river ecosystems.
Opportunities and Economic Benefits of the Energy Transition
Switzerland’s energy transition presents major economic and business opportunities, making sustainability a competitive advantage rather than a cost.
1. Green Job Creation
- The renewable energy sector is expected to generate thousands of new jobs, from engineers and technicians to sustainability consultants and green finance specialists.
2. Innovation and Research Leadership
- Switzerland’s universities and research institutions are at the forefront of clean energy innovation, developing new solar panel technologies, energy storage solutions, and AI-driven energy management systems.
- The country’s leadership in cleantech startups is attracting global investment.
3. Sustainable Finance and Investment Growth
- Switzerland is a global hub for sustainable finance, with banks and investment firms increasingly focusing on green bonds, impact investing, and carbon-neutral portfolios.
4. Strengthened Energy Independence
- Reducing reliance on imported fossil fuels enhances national energy security and shields Switzerland from volatile global energy prices.
